Position Summary
The Associate Actuary will be responsible for supporting Healthmap’s strategic and operational initiatives through data analytics and modeling. This individual will develop pricing and risk models for new or prospective clients, analyze operational results for existing clients, and report results to C-Suite management and external clients where appropriate. This individual will have the opportunity for continued advancement toward actuarial designation through Healthmap’s competitive actuarial program.


Responsibilities
 

  • Develop complex actuarial and medical economics models including trend calculations, reserving estimates, risk score calculations, risk assessments and savings analyses
  • Develop actuarial and medical economic models used to forecast cost and utilization statistics
  • Compile, organize, categorize, and analyze large data sets using SQL
  • Collaborate with various internal and external stakeholders to identify, troubleshoot, and resolve business problems
  • Work with various cross-functional teams including sales, data sciences, product development, and clinical services
  • Make decisions on moderately complex to complex issues regarding technical approach and work is performed with minimal or no direction
  • Perform other related duties as assigned

Requirements 

  • Bachelor’s degree in mathematics, statistics, actuarial science, or similar background
  • Associate of Society of Actuaries (ASA) designation preferred
  • 5-10 years practical work experience preferred

Skills
 

  • Strong written and oral communication skills
  • Familiarity with medical economics and actuarial forecasting
  • Must be highly proficient in Microsoft Office: Outlook, Word, Excel, PowerPoint
